Judd Falls Trail is a popular and family-friendly hiking destination near Crested Butte, Colorado. The trail offers great views of Gothic Mountain, wildflowers, and a beautiful waterfall. It's a relatively easy hike, making it suitable for families with children. The trail is well-maintained and has a short distance of about 1 mile, with an elevation gain of 166 feet. The area is also home to the Rocky Mountain Biological Laboratory, which adds an element of scientific interest to the hike. Visitors can enjoy the scenic views, wildflowers, and the sound of the waterfall, making it a great place to spend time with family and friends

Activities: We hiked to Judd Falls from the main parking lot, a nice and easy distance for kids, about 1.1-1.2 miles. We enjoyed the interpretive signs along the way, teaching about the history of the area and importance of research in the wildflower-infested habitat
